CNC Machining is a procedure utilized in the manufacturing industry that involves the use of computers to manage device devices. Devices that can be controlled in this manner consist of lathes, mills, routers and grinders. The CNC in CNC Machining represents Computer system Numerical Control.

On the surface, it could look like a regular PC regulates the devices, but the computer‘s distinct software and control console are what really sets the system apart for usage in CNC machining.

Under CNC Machining, machine tools operate via numerical control. A computer program is personalized for an item and the machines are configured with CNC machining language (called G-code) that basically manages all attributes like feed rate, control, place as well as speeds. With CNC machining, the computer could regulate specific positioning and velocity. CNC machining is made use of in making both metal and plastic parts.

First a CAD illustration is created (either 2D or 3D), and after that a code is developed that the CNC maker will certainly recognize. The program is packed and also finally an operator runs a test of the program to guarantee there are not a problem. This dry run is described as “cutting air“ as well as it is an essential action since any error with speed and also tool position might result in a scratched component or a harmed maker.

There are numerous benefits to using CNC Machining. The procedure is much more accurate than hand-operated machining, as well as can be duplicated in exactly the exact same manner over and over again. Due to the precision feasible with CNC Machining, this procedure could create complicated shapes that would certainly be almost impossible to attain with hand-operated machining. CNC Machining is utilized in the manufacturing of lots of complex three-dimensional forms. It is as a result of these qualities that CNC Machining is used in jobs that require a high level of accuracy or very repetitive jobs.
